Methods of producing a panto compound, pantothenate and beta alanine, increasing the production of a panto compound and to identify compounds that modulate the activity of pantothenate kinase.The recombinant vector, microorganism, molecule of nucleic acid isolation, polipetu00ecdeo proteu00ecna pantothenate kinase and the isolated. The present invention describes methods of producing panto compounds (for example,Pantothenate) using microorganisms in the path biossintu00e9tu00edco of pantothenate biosynthetic and / or the way of isoleucine, valine and / or biosynthetic path of coenzimaa has been manipulated.The methods of microorganisms that supraexpressam the cetopantoato reductase as well as microorganisms that supraexpressam aspartate decarboxylase - 244 is provided.Methods of producing panto compounds in a way independent of the precursor and high yield are described.Recombinant microorganisms, vectors, isolated nucleic acid molecules, genes and gene products are useful in the practice of the methods above are also provided.The present invention also portrays a microbial pantothenate kinase gene not identified previously, coax,As well as methods to produce panto compounds using microorganisms having the modified pantothenate kinase activity.Recombinant microorganisms, vectors, nucleic acid molecules isolated and purified coax coax proteins are depicted.They also reveal methods to identify modulators of pantothenate kinase using recombinant microorganisms and / or the protein of the present invention purified coax.
